OpenAI, Meta, and xAI Race to Define the Agentic AI Era
With a single news cycle, three of the world’s most influential AI labs shipped significant new products. OpenAI unveiled a workplace automation agent, Meta opened developer access to its latest models, and xAI pushed its flagship model forward on coding and agentic capabilities. The common thread: every major lab is now betting heavily on AI agents as the next primary use case for foundation models.
